      Psychologically, both teams are accustomed to high-pressure environments, but their approaches differ. England often rely on momentum and attacking confidence, while Uruguay thrive on discipline, patience, and experience. This contrast adds an extra layer of intrigue to the contest. In conclusion, England vs Uruguay is a matchup that highlights the diversity of footballing philosophies. England’s modern, attacking approach faces Uruguay’s disciplined and efficient style. The outcome will likely depend on execution in key moments, defensive concentration, and the ability to adapt to changing dynamics within the match. This promises to be a tightly contested and high-quality international encounter.

    • Switzerland vs Germany Prediction and Betting Tips | 28 March 2026 Switzerland and Germany face off in a high-profile friendly on Friday, with 1-2 our predicted outcome. Switzerland boss Murat Yakin heavily leans on experience, with his squad featuring key names such as Breel Embolo, Granit Xhaka, Remo Freuler, Ricardo Rodríguez, and Manuel Akanji, while Dan Ndoye earns a call-up despite his shaky club form. Switzerland enter the match in excellent shape, averaging 2.40 points per game over their last ten outings and winning 70% of them. Their defensive stability stands out as well, with only 0.60 goals conceded per match and 50% clean sheets. Germany, on the other hand, travel to Basel without injured goalkeeper Manuel Neuer, but Kai Havertz returns to action. Surprisingly, Jamal Musiala has been left out despite his impressive club form.
